An indie game framed around civil unrest, RIOT: Civil Unrest launched in 2019 from developer leonard-menchiari and publisher Silver Lining Interactive. It has 1,932 Steam reviews at 68% positive, a mixed-to-positive signal, with an initial price of $16.99.

indielist estimates lifetime unit sales for RIOT: Civil Unrest at roughly 53,000 to 124,000 copies, with a median around 89,000, derived from its 1,616 Steam reviews using a multi-factor Boxleiter method (version v1.0). That median maps to approximately $863K in net revenue after Steam's 30% cut, regional pricing, and refunds. Unlike black-box trackers, the full calculation is shown on this page: a base review-to-sales multiplier is adjusted for release year, launch price, review sentiment, studio size, and genre, and every adjustment is listed so developers, publishers, and investors can audit exactly how the figure was reached. The range itself reflects genuine uncertainty — review-to-sales ratios vary widely between games — so indielist publishes a low, median, and high band rather than a false-precision single number, and treats free-to-play, heavily discounted, and bundle-distributed titles as having wider error margins still.
